Abstract
We present a measurement of the distribution of the variable for muon pairs with masses between 30 and 500 GeV, using the complete run II data set collected by the D0 detector at the Fermilab Tevatron proton-antiproton collider. This corresponds to an integrated luminosity of at . The data are corrected for detector effects and presented in bins of dimuon rapidity and mass. The variable probes the same physical effects as the boson transverse momentum, but is less susceptible to the effects of experimental resolution and efficiency. These are the first measurements at any collider of the distributions for dilepton masses away from the boson mass peak. The data are compared to QCD predictions based on the resummation of multiple soft gluons.
